Didgeridoo Festivals HQ, located in Augustine Heights, Queensland, is a cultural center dedicated to sharing Aboriginal culture through a variety of engaging activities and events. Visitors can participate in workshops to make their own didgeridoos, join music jams, or enjoy performances that celebrate traditional storytelling, dance, and art.
The facility offers handcrafted, authentic eucalyptus didgeridoos that are naturally hollowed by termites, ensuring no living trees or animals are harmed. With programs tailored for all ages, including educational workshops for schools and private groups, Didgeridoo Festivals HQ aims to provide a genuine cultural experience while paying respect to the Traditional Custodians of the land, the Yuggara and Ugarapul people.
